R-94-11-22-10J - 11/22/1994WHEREAS, the subdivider of the subdivision known as Reserve at Oak
Bluff subdivision has applied to the City for acceptance of certain
offsite improvements consisting of drainage and wastewater system
improvements ("Improvements ")located within Oak Bluff Estates, Phase 2,
for maintenance by the City, and
WHEREAS, the subdivider has filed with the City Engineer an one
(1) year warranty bond against defects in materials and workmanship in
said Improvements, and
WHEREAS, the subdivider has filed with the City Engineer one (1)
set of reproducible "AS BUILT" plans for the Improvements, which further
contains or has attached thereto a certificate of a registered
professional engineer as required by §8.601(3)(b) of the City Code, and
WHEREAS, the subdivider has filed with the City Engineer an
affidavit that to the best of his information and belief, the
contractor(s) has complied with the regulations contained in Chapter 8
of the City Code, Now Therefore,
